圖示位置出現遮罩層,下面滾動; 原因: touchmove事件冒泡; 解決方法: 冒泡就要阻止,在遮罩層阻止冒泡,小程序里面 catch+時間名可以阻止冒泡, 所以 在遮罩層填上事件 catchtouchmove="preventdefault" 小程序 ...
轉自:https: www.jianshu.com p fb c bbd 實現遮罩效果 Html CSS 阻止遮罩層下的頁面滾動 只需要在遮罩層上加上catchtouchmove ture 需要注意的是:因模擬器無touch事件,需在真機上測試 ...
2019-12-23 02:17 0 1061 推薦指數:
圖示位置出現遮罩層,下面滾動; 原因: touchmove事件冒泡; 解決方法: 冒泡就要阻止,在遮罩層阻止冒泡,小程序里面 catch+時間名可以阻止冒泡, 所以 在遮罩層填上事件 catchtouchmove="preventdefault" 小程序 ...
如果彈出層沒有滾動事件: 如果彈出層有滾動事件,那么在彈出層出現的時候給底部的containerView加上一個class 消失的時候移除。 ...
發現當有滾動條時就出現問題了。 經過改動的代碼如下 完美解決。 從上面的問題中我們總結出以上兩條經驗。 1、fixed的的作用是 2、讓一個層在body中全部占滿有下面的方式 http://www.cnblogs.com/kaisela ...
wxml //使用scroll-view包裹 scrolly-y要寫 [scroll-view scroll-y class="mask-box" catchtouchmove='ture'] [vi ...
1.放一個空div,作為遮罩層最外層 2.寫這個遮罩層樣式 其中顏色可以任選,透明度也可以任選。 兼容處理: 3.控制顯示還是隱藏 用v-if或者hiddle的true和false來控制遮罩的顯示或者隱藏,當flag設置為false時,隱藏;為true時,顯示 ...
問題:小程序自定遮罩層時,滾動遮罩層時,滾動效果會穿透,影響page頁面的滾動,影響用戶體驗度。 解決方案: 如果彈出框無滾動區域,直接將這個彈出框和遮罩層的父元素catchtouchmove='ture' 如果彈出框有滾動區域,如果自定義了catchtouchmove就會阻止內部 ...
問題:微信小程序中,我們常使用遮罩層,如點擊按鈕彈出下拉框、彈框等等。若在遮罩層下存在input、textarea、canvas、camera、map、video等標簽時,會出現遮罩層覆蓋失效的問題。實際上,這個問題在開發者工具上並不會出現,卻會出現在真機上。 原因:微信小程序官方文檔指明 ...